The Canisius College softball and baseball teams are combining efforts to “Strike Out Cancer” next week.  The softball team hosts Syracuse in a doubleheader on Tuesday, May 4 beginning at 3 p.m. and the baseball team battles Niagara is a single contest on Wednesday, May 5 at 3 p.m.  All games will be played at the Demske Sports Complex.

Both teams will wear pink hats, and to contribute to the efforts, Canisius College fans, boosters, faculty, staff, administrators and students have two options – donate a set dollar amount or make a pledge based on the number of strikeouts recorded on either or both days.

For softball, it will be the total number of strikeouts thrown by Canisius in both games of the Syracuse twin bill.  For baseball it will be the number of strikeouts registered by both Niagara and Canisius (Niagara’s fans are also contributing to the event).
